Boris Johnson's announcement of new coronavirus measures caused 'confusion' for businesses, says CBI chief

that the prime minister was calling for the re-opening of parts of the British economy the following day.

Fairbairn welcomed the decision to gradually loosen the UK's lockdown measures, warning that acting too quickly risked a spike in infections and a second lockdown which would be even perilous for business than the first."We've spoken to so many businesses who have basically said to us: 'knock me down once and I'll get up again. Knock me down again and I might not get up.'

"There are a lot of businesses out there who are really surprised by how well working from home has gone," she said. "I think there are going to be a number of businesses who really rethink their use of office space. I've had many conversations with large businesses who are already reviewing their property strategy."

"We have been encouraged so far that they have listened. We know that they are actively considering what the new wave of furlough of support can be for those businesses that cannot open."
